Meaning & origin

Tirzah is a rare but steadily reviving biblical name with a gentle meaning. First recorded in U.S. births in 1899, it faded for much of the 20th century but has been climbing since the 1990s. Its peak came in 2017, and as of 2025 it ranks 2,751, given to roughly 1 in 25,924 girls. The name is most popular in Minnesota, Texas, and California, reflecting a niche but geographically broad appeal. Tirzah carries Old Testament weight without being overused, making it a distinctive choice for parents drawn to quiet, traditional names.

Tirzah is a Hebrew name derived from the word "tirtsah" meaning "pleasantness" or "delight." In the Old Testament, Tirzah was a Canaanite royal city prized for its beauty, and also the name of one of Zelophehad's daughters in Numbers. The name has been used among English-speaking Christians since the 17th century, particularly by Puritans who valued Old Testament names.

Questions parents ask

What does the name Tirzah mean?
Tirzah means 'pleasantness' or 'delight' in Hebrew, stemming from the biblical city and a daughter of Zelophehad.
How popular is Tirzah?
Tirzah is rare; as of 2025 it ranked 2,751 in the U.S. with about 1 in 25,924 girls given the name. It has been rising in use since the 1990s.
Is Tirzah a boy or girl name?
Tirzah is almost exclusively used as a girl's name, consistent with its biblical feminine origin.
